Integrating Industry 4.0 technologies into the circular economy has received much attention in the literature in recent years. Considering the ladder of lansink and circular economy technical cycle, reusing and remanufacturing are preferable to recycling. Disassembly is a crucial process in remanufacturing. Collaborative robots provide semi-autonomous disassembly and could enhance product remanufacturing considering the uncertainties, cost reduction, and circularity of materials. This paper aims to discuss the application of lean practices in a disassembly cell with operators-robots collaboration. A conceptual framework based on the house of lean is proposed to highlight the research perspectives on opportunities of lean philosophy in disassembly operation enabled with industry 4.0 technology.
